Ingredients

This low fat chicken thigh crock pot recipe requires the following ingredients:

  • 2 lbs. chicken thighs, skinless and boneless
  • 1 large onion, diced
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 carrots, diced
  • 2 stalks celery, diced
  • 1 cup low-sodium chicken broth
  • 1 tsp. dried thyme
  • 1 tsp. dried oregano
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

To make this low fat chicken thigh crock pot recipe, follow these simple steps:

  1. Place the chicken thighs in the slow cooker.
  2. Add the onion, garlic, carrots, and celery to the slow cooker.
  3. Pour the chicken broth over the vegetables and chicken.
  4. Sprinkle the thyme, oregano, salt, and pepper over the ingredients.
  5. Cover and cook on low for 4-6 hours, or until the chicken is cooked through and the vegetables are tender.
  6. Serve and enjoy!

Notes

It is important to use low-sodium chicken broth for this recipe, as it will reduce the amount of sodium in the dish. If you are looking for a vegetarian version of this recipe, you can substitute the chicken for mushrooms or other vegetables of your choice.

Nutrition: Per Serving

This low fat chicken thigh crock pot recipe yields 4 servings. Each serving contains approximately:

  • Calories: 224 kcal
  • Fat: 6.9 g
  • Carbohydrates: 8.1 g
  • Protein: 28.0 g
  • Fiber: 3.2 g

Recipe Tips

To make this recipe even healthier, you can substitute the chicken thighs for turkey thighs or skinless chicken breast. You can also add more vegetables to the slow cooker for an even heartier stew. If you are looking for a creamier version of this recipe, you can add a can of low-fat cream of mushroom soup to the slow cooker. For a spicier version, you can add a pinch of cayenne pepper or a teaspoon of chili powder to the recipe.
